## Formula sandbox tuning

User-supplied formulas in Gridmoor execute inside a restricted interpreter with hard ceilings on time, memory, and call depth. Reviewers should confirm any change to these ceilings is justified in the PR description, since raising them widens the abuse surface. Defaults were chosen from production traces. The current limits are as follows.

limits module of tafog-fawip:
WEIGHTS = {
    "julix": 57,
    "lamys": 992,
    "kasvan": 209,
    "quenok": 750,
    "alddor": 259,
    "oliath": 1009,
    "wenix": 815,
}

Step 4: Deploy BranchWeigh, the experiment assignment service, to the Tallow cluster. Build the container from the release tag, not main. Push to the internal registry and apply the rollout manifest with the canary flag set. Assignments are cached, so drain old pods slowly. The release artifact must be signed before the registry accepts it; use the key below.

rollout seal: bky6_MeoCCt

Q: How are loyalty points recorded when my plugin issues an adjustment?

A: Every adjustment on the Wrenmark ledger is append-only; plugins never mutate balances directly. Submit a signed adjustment event and the ledger applies it after validation, typically within two minutes. Reversals require a matching correction event. The full event schema and validation rules are documented on this internal page.

runbook for badug-kadup: https://confluence.zemvarlabs.internal/projects/browse/display/projects/bd1b

**Vendor note: Inkmill markdown pipeline**

Rendering for Parchway docs is outsourced to Inkmill under an annual contract, renewing each March. They handle sanitization and PDF export; we own the upload queue. SLA: 4-hour response on rendering failures. Escalate only after two failed retries. Their support desk is reachable at the address below.

billing contact of hahaf-baguf = zorael.tammir.jorius@sivrelhq.internal

Deploy step 4: EXIF scrubbing. Photon-Wipe strips location and camera metadata from every upload before storage. New folks: this runs on the Larkfield workers, not the API tier, so the worker env must carry the scrubber's signing credential. Open the worker .env and add the following line to enable authenticated scrub jobs.

sealed setting: RELAY_SECRET29=2d90f50448baa6c07af134de232e6